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
26473035 20 14136744 4141596 69518
7446415963 49138 63871392
7446415963 49138 63871392
556 95303252 386 8566424
All about undefined
Interested in learning more?
7446415963 49138 63871392
556 95303252 386 8566424
See more
81 88 292
28288 19 719 921181 516854
See more
81516551 3434 5040
5795900085 26929199773 42 14503
See more